A plane crash. Sixteen young actors and actresses emerge from the smoking hull exploded onto the stage. They know each other well, they studied together. But the story they tell is not about an air disaster, but about the world-catastrophe-in which they live, here and now.

For the Studio 7 graduation show at the École du Nord, David Bobée and Éric Lacascade, godparents of the student actors, have chosen to listen to this generation, its singularities, its multiple views of the world, its violence and its joy. To let them speak, so that each and every one of them can take their place on stage. The student authors, accompanied by their mentor Éva Doumbia, will be tasked with putting into words and orchestrating the proposals of their fellow performers.

This will be stage writing, a fragmentary narrative, telling the story of how this generation rebuilds, repairs and reinvents, with great creativity, the world that has been left to them. A permanent reinvention, all the freer for being born from ruins, all the more joyful for being without hope.
